Police negotiators are trying to save an elderly woman trapped inside a property with a knife-wielding man.
Officers were called to the house in Sandwell, West Midlands, on Sunday morning after concerns for the woman's welfare were raised.
The incident is believed to be domestic-related and is still ongoing, with officers working to bring it to an end.
Chief Superintendent Phil Kay, from West Midlands Police, said: "Officers received an emergency call this morning regarding concerns for the welfare of a woman aged in her 80s, who lives at an address in Oldbury.
"Police made further inquiries which confirmed that a man aged in his 40s was also inside the property in Perry Hill Road and was armed with a knife. At this stage the incident is believed to be domestic-related.
"Specialist officers including force negotiators remain at the scene this evening as they continue to try and bring the situation to a peaceful and safe resolution."
